A genuine oak refectory table made in the latter part of the 19th century.
It has the advantage of a pretty shaped stretcher that will enable the dining chairs to be tucked in underneath the table .The cup and cover legs are well carved and of generous proportions.
The condition is good and the colour is excellent. However there are marks on the top which should be expected with antiques of this age. We could arrange to have them polished out should the buyer prefer but honestly they are 'battle scars'! and are not to the detriment of the overall look .
We estimate that this table will seat 12.
